Required Qualifications:

Completion of post-secondary education in a health care profession or a related field. Minimum 2 years' experience in a leadership capacity. Project Management training. Prosci change Management training or equivalent. Minimum 5 years’ experience working as a paramedic. This position includes oversight of programming that addresses and supports staff experiences of patient-to-worker harassment and violence. The incumbent must display strong mental resiliency and demonstrate proactive and continuous self-care practices, including maintaining appropriate professional boundaries to ensure mitigation of compassion fatigue/burnout.


Additional Required Qualifications:

Demonstrated ability to advise and coach leaders and employees. Demonstrated ability to manage change and create innovative solutions for complex and diverse issues. Demonstrated skills/experience in leading program development, change management, stakeholder engagement and project management. Advanced knowledge of the safe workplace culture challenges facing paramedic organizations. Public speaking and facilitation skills. Collaborative engagement skills and proven ability to foster relationships with internal and external stakeholders. Valid Alberta Class 5 Operators License with no more than 6 demerits in accordance with AHS EMS Fleet policies and procedures.


Preferred Qualifications:

Minimum 2 years’ experience leading a safety/change management project in healthcare/government environment Minimum 2 years experience in a leadership capacity Registered with the Alberta College of Paramedics Training or experience with trauma informed practices A combination of education, skills and experience may be considered.
